We use the Gospel Project for Kids curriculum for the Children's Ministry at GLC.  The Gospel Project for Kids is a Christ-centered ongoing weekly Bible study resource that looks at the big picture of God's story, the story of redemption through Jesus Christ. Each week, kids of all ages will follow a chronological timeline of Bible events while learning how each story points to the gospel of Jesus Christ.

Healings in Galilee

This upcoming Sunday your child will learn about: Healings in Galilee
Story Point from Mark 1; Luke 4-5: Jesus showed his care for people by healing them.
Family Bible Reading: How great are his miracles, and how mighty his wonders! His kingdom is an eternal kingdom, and his dominion is from generation to generation. Daniel 4:3
Big Picture Question: Why did Jesus perform miracles?
Big Picture Answer: Jesus performed miracles to glorify God, to show He is the Son of God, and to care for people.

Gospel Gems to Discuss at Home

Gospel Tots (ages 1 & 2 years old)
  • Jesus came to heal us from our sin and forgive us when we ask.
Gospel Tykes (ages 3 - 5 years old) 
  • Jesus cared for a man who was very sick and made him better. Sin is like being sick inside, but Jesus can take away our sin when we ask Him.
Gospel Kids (K - 2nd grade)
  • Jesus was willing to heal the man's skin and make him clean. Jesus is also willing save those who humble themselves, repent of their sin, and trust in Him.
